What is Physical Therapy Billing and Why It Matters?
Physical therapy insurance billing means sending claims to insurance companies and collecting payments for services.
It sounds simple. But there are many steps involved.
The process includes:
- Patient registration.
- Insurance verification.
- Documentation.
- Coding.
- Claims submission.
- Payment posting.
- Denial management.
Good physical therapy in medical billing helps practices stay financially healthy. Bad billing can create many problems.
For example:
- Payments may be delayed.
- Claims may be denied.
- Staff may spend extra time fixing errors.
- Revenue may go down.
Nobody wants that. That is why having a strong billing process matters.
Understanding Core Physical Therapy Billing Components
There are several parts of physical therapy billing. Each part is important.
Patient Registration
Everything starts here. Patient details must be correct. Wrong information can lead to claim rejection.
Important details include:
- Name.
- Date of birth.
- Insurance information.
- Physician information.
Simple mistakes can create big delays.
Insurance Verification
This step should never be skipped. Benefits should be checked before treatment starts.
This helps practices know:
- Copays.
- Deductibles.
- Visit limits.
- Authorization requirements.
Checking benefits early helps avoid surprises later.
Documentation
Good notes matter.
Therapists should document:
- Treatments performed.
- Patient progress.
- Goals.
- Time spent.
Strong notes support physical therapy medical billing. Poor notes often lead to denials.
Coding
Correct codes are very important.
Some common codes are:

Step-by-Step Physical Therapy Billing Process
The process is easier when it is broken into steps.
Step 1: Schedule the Patient
Collect patient information. Get insurance details. Make sure everything is correct.
Step 2: Verify Insurance
Check:
- Coverage.
- Copays.
- Deductibles.
- Authorization requirements.
This step helps prevent denied claims.
Step 3: Complete Documentation
Good notes help support the claim. Clear notes also show medical necessity.
Step 4: Enter Codes
Use the right codes and modifiers. Accurate coding improves physical therapy insurance billing.
Step 5: Submit Claims
Send claims quickly. Electronic claims help speed up payments.
Step 6: Post Payments
Record payments correctly. Review remaining balances.
Step 7: Handle Denials
Some claims get denied. That happens. Fix the problem and send the claim again. This helps practices get paid sooner.
Step 8: Follow Up on Unpaid Claims
Some claims take time to get paid. Do not let them sit for too long. Regular follow-up helps bring in payments faster.

FAQs
What are the most common CPT codes in physical therapy?
Some common codes include:
- 97110 for therapeutic exercise.
- 97112 for neuromuscular reeducation.
- 97140 for manual therapy.
- 97530 for therapeutic activities.
These codes are used often in physical therapy billing.
What is the 8-minute rule in PT billing?
The 8-minute rule helps determine how many units can be billed.
- At least eight minutes are needed for one unit.
- More treatment time allows more units.
- Good documentation is important.
This rule is common in physical therapy insurance billing.
Why are physical therapy claims denied?
Claims may be denied because of:
- Wrong codes.
- Missing notes.
- Missing authorization.
- Insurance problems.
- Modifier errors.
- Late filing.
Most of these issues can be prevented.
